Artist Statement
With various media, I create works that address human and environmental themes of imbalance and regained equilibrium.
Recently, I completed, Arroyo as Metaphor, an erosion abatement project on site in New Mexico.
The Jellies are a celebration of the luminous beauty and ultimate endurance of this species. The Eight Brocades fiber pieces are inspired by an ancient Chinese healing exercise believed to restore the body’s vital energy and balance. Acid Rain and the The Scent of Plumeria tree paintings are very personal landscapes about loss and the restorative effect of beauty. The Sound of the Sea, and the Sea, My Bones lithographs reflect my emotional engagement with raging seas and vanishing corals.
